Wesleyan Methodist Church, Dundee

Wesleyan Methodist Church, Dundee - Ref: WC1450


This Wesleyan Church is situated in Ward Road. It opened in June, 1867. Built to replace a smaller church in Tally Street, it could seat 700. Two classrooms and a vestry were build underneath.

The building is still recogniseable today, though it is no longer a church. The tramlines are, however, long gone.(2001)


Alexander Wilson who took this photograph, was a supervisor in a Dundee jute mill for over 20 years. He bequeathed much of his collection and £50, to cover the costs involved, to the Free Library Committee of Dundee in 1923.
